What is sustainability? Sustainability refers to the ability to meet the needs of the present without comp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own needs. It is about striking a balance between economic, social, and environmental aspects of development to ensure long-term sustainability.
Why is sustainability important? Sustainability is important because it promotes responsible use of resources and ensures that we leave a habitable planet for future generations. Climate change, environmental degradation, and loss of biodiversity are some of the major issues that threaten our planet's sustainability.
Eco-friendly living Eco-friendly living involves making conscious choices to reduce our environmental impact. Some ways to practice eco-friendly living include reducing energy consumption, conserving water, reducing waste, and using eco-friendly products.
Reducing energy consumption Reducing energy consumption is an essential aspect of eco-friendly living. This can be achieved by using energy-efficient appliances, turning off lights and electronics when not in use, and using natural light and ventilation whenever possible.
Conserving water Conserving water is another important aspect of eco-friendly living. Some ways to conserve water include fixing leaks, taking shorter showers, and using a low-flow toilet and showerhead.
Reducing waste Reducing waste is critical to eco-friendly living. Some ways to reduce waste include recycling, composting, and buying products with minimal packaging.
Using eco-friendly products Using eco-friendly products is an essential aspect of sustainability. Eco-friendly products are those that are made from sustainable materials, are biodegradable, or have a minimal impact on the environment.
Sustainable transportation Sustainable transportation is another aspect of eco-friendly living. It involves using public transportation, carpooling, biking, or walking instead of driving alone. This reduces greenhouse gas emissions and promotes physical activity.
Sustainable food choices Sustainable food choices involve choosing locally sourced, organic, and non-GMO foods. It also means reducing meat consumption and choosing plant-based options whenever possible.
Green home design Green home design involves designing homes that are energy-efficient, use sustainable materials, and have minimal impact on the environment. This includes using renewable energy sources, such as solar and wind power, and incorporating green spaces, such as gardens and green roofs.
